Following his team's 27-24 overtime loss to the Cowboys on Sunday, Redskins cornerback DeAngelo Hall said the team should cut him loose. "The way I'm playing right now, they need to go and cut me, because I'm definitely not worth what I'm getting," Hall said. "It's frustrating. "Hopefully they see something in me and bring me back next year. But the way things are going right now, I'm definitely not playing up to par." The source of Hall's dejection was a critical third-and-15 situation the Cowboys converted in overtime, when receiver Dez Bryant beat Hall for a 26-yard reception that set up the winning field goal. It also didn't help that Hall allowed Bryant to get behind him for a 22-yard touchdown on the Cowboys' opening drive.
